释义 | launderer noun[ C ] uk /ˈlɔːn.dər.ər/ us /ˈlɑːn.dɚ.ɚ/ launderernoun[C] (MONEY)someone who moves money that has been obtained illegally through banks and other businesses to make it seem to have been obtained legally: 洗钱者 Launderers often export the money to countries with relaxed banking regulations. In the "loan-back" scheme, the launderer essentially borrows money from himself.在“回贷”方案中,洗钱者实质上是向自己借钱。 Synonym money launderer Launderers have smuggled cash into offshore countries in everything from coffins to wooden legs. In the film, he plays a launderer of dirty money. Among the favourite targets of launderers are antique dealers, car traders, auction houses, and Rolex watches.
